Title:
  alsa/hda/realtek: fix a mute led regression on Lenovo X1 Carbon

Bug description:
  [Impact]
  The mute led couldn't work after applying the FIXUP_SPEAKER2_TO_DAC1.

  [Fix]
  Chain a fixup to let mute led work.

  [Test Case]
  boot the system, press mute button, the led will work.

  
  [Regression Risk]
  Low, this patch is specific to LENOVO X1 Carbon machines. And
  I tested this patch on Lenovo and Dell machines.
